4. Tooth mobility

When it comes to early signs of root canals, this one is pretty hard to ignore! After all, having our teeth move is not normal, and when you start to show signs, you will need a root canal treatment done pretty soon.

If your tooth feels loose, then it may be a sign that your nerve is dying, or it can be a sign of a root canal. Either way, both of these causes of your teeth’s mobility are nothing to close your eyes to, and you should see a specialist pretty soon.

Keep in mind that if you happen to notice tooth mobility in more than one tooth, then there is a chance that you have other underlying issues, and a root canal is not the cause of them.
